About this index

We keep this list because we read the field and wanted one place to see it. It covers work on continual learning itself, in the core areas of machine learning, and leaves out papers that apply it inside another field, such as medical imaging or fault diagnosis. By default it shows the papers we have a reason to trust: published at a venue like NeurIPS, ICML, ICLR, CVPR or TPAMI, or written by someone who has published there, or cited a few hundred times. The rest are one click away under “All papers”. It is seeded from the community lists kept by ContinualAI and by Xialei Liu, then filled out from OpenAlex, and every week a script looks for new papers on OpenAlex and arXiv. A model reads each candidate and decides whether it belongs; a person reviews the additions before they go live. Authors and affiliations come from OpenAlex, so a recent preprint can lack its institutions for a week or two.
